Sawyer, a software platform for kid classes, raises $6 million, including from the Chan Zuckerberg Initiative
Much like venture-backed outfits KidPass and Pearachute, customers of Sawyer (who are parents and caregivers mostly) can pay for classes featured directly on its website. Unlike many services that charge a fixed price per month, and/or a membership fee, however, the classes are available à la carte, and no membership is required.
Source: techcrunch.com
New Startup Helps Parents Find And Sign Up Their Children For Summer Activities
In addition, there are other child-focused, drop-in activity booking websites popping up around KidPass. Sawyer currently offers a similar service for New York City and Los Angeles while Pearachute covers Chicago, Dallas, and Kansas City. The founders of KidPass would be wise to keep an eye on them in order to see what’s working (and what’s not) both inside and outside of...
